Abe Anderson, Bexar County, Texas, 1867
Abe Anderson registered to vote in Bexar County on July 9, 1867. He reported Tennessee as his birthplace and 2 years in Texas. The registrar wrote "Colored" beside his name. Bexar County registered 500 freedmen in 1867, 22% of its voters.

This entry comes from the 1867 to 1870 Texas voter registration, the Texas Secretary of State registration lists held by the Texas State Library and Archives Commission. It sits on page 11 of the Bexar County volume, written out by hand. About Enslaved Texas.
